Overview
The Diploma in Embedded Systems and VLSI (DESV) is a 3-year program focusing on the design, development, and testing of embedded systems and Very Large Scale Integration (VLSI) circuits. Graduates gain expertise in hardware-software integration, microcontrollers, and chip design, preparing them for careers in electronics product development.

Who should study?
This program is ideal for students who have completed their 10th or 12th standard (with a science or vocational background) and are fascinated by how electronic devices work. It suits individuals with a keen interest in hardware-software interaction, circuit design, microcontrollers, and the development of smart, integrated systems.

Common Misconceptions:
This diploma is often confused with a pure computer science or electrical engineering diploma. It specifically bridges the gap between hardware (VLSI) and software (embedded programming), requiring a blend of both skills.
State-Specific Note:
Admission processes and specific course structures can vary significantly between states. It's crucial to check the guidelines from the respective state's Directorate of Technical Education or equivalent body.
